UKSP aims to be no more than just another kitchen sink pack.

It was developed to share some of my favorite mods of the 1.12.2 modded Minecraft era with my friends on our private server. But just like the mods selected for this pack, I intend to execute well, for fun and for server performance.

So, what is UKSP about?

Well at it's core it's really a pile of mods I think my players will like, thus the kitchen sink bit, but they are selected and configured carefully to provide a certain experience. That experience being a healthy balance of tech, magic, decor and exploration.

This is not a quest pack, nor an expert pack or even a highly "balanced" pack. Most mods are included as is with some tweaks mostly to world gen rates for performance and avoidance of clustered landscapes. That being said there are no heavily OP mods in the pack in the realm of Project E, or Draconic Evolution etc.

OK but what's actually in it?

Well the full mod list isn't getting pasted here, you can find that in the relations but here ya go. This is a pack that features beautiful world gen through Biome Bundle and OTG, deep magical mods of witchcraft, wizardry, the stars and sacrifice. There are nuclear reactors and rockets, fierce dragons, and a slew of unique and fun dimensions. But seriously there are mods and lots of them, from furniture and hats, to summoning Cthulhu himself the best way to really find out is to try the pack for yourself.
